When Tooth Decay Is Present

You may not notice it, but your teeth may be covered in plaque, and this can cause tooth decay. Unfortunately, the indicators are very difficult to find during the first stage of tooth decay.

Your teeth’s enamel may start to lose its minerals because the acid from plaque melts them away, causing the teeth to have white spots. These white spots are harder to notice as they could easily blend in with your teeth’s natural color.

Teeth cleaning is one of the basic procedures in dentistry. This can be done to get rid of the plaque and tartar covering the teeth. It lessens the presence of bacteria in your teeth as well. And if you want to brighten up your smile once your free of bacteria, a teeth whitening treatment can help give you the smile of your dreams.

When Discoloration Occurs

Discoloration can appear as a result of various causes. Some people are just blessed with naturally white teeth, but that isn’t the case for many. Even if you are someone with white teeth, that can quickly change due to the foods and drinks you consume. Smoking and even aging can also cause your teeth to gradually fade to a yellowish color.

The great news is that a cosmetic dentist can bring the beautiful shine back to your smile through teeth whitening or veneers. The choice is up to you, but you might want to discuss your options with the dentist so you can make the best decision for your unique situation.

When a Cavity Forms

Sometimes discoloration is a sign of your teeth becoming brittle, and after a few weeks, small holes called cavities can start forming. This is where the infection begins to happen by softening the dentin, which imposes a danger when left untreated.

Cosmetic dentists can fill the cavities to avoid bacteria advancing toward the pulp and causing a painful infection or worse, dental abscesses, which are painful and uncomfortable. We do not want it to lead to a tooth extraction, right?

When You Have an Accident

While you were physically active, you tripped on something, causing you to fall and break your teeth. Such damages are called cracks or chips, depending on how the damage looks.

Many people tend to ignore these damages as if no infection will occur. But this is not supposed to be the case! We should go to a cosmetic dentist when we get cracks and chips in our smile!

If these cracks and chips are left untreated, you may experience pain and discomfort while eating your favorite meals and drinking liquids. The worst-case scenario is that the cracked or chipped teeth can get infected as bacteria can get in easily.

Cosmetic dentists usually perform the following treatments:  

  • Dental filling
  • Dental bonding
  • Dental cap or crown,  
  • Veneers
  • Root canal treatment  

It will all depend on the severity of the damage present in your teeth.

When Your Teeth are Crooked

Some of our teeth may have been crooked since they first came in, affecting our self-esteem. In other cases, an impactful accident caused our teeth to shift.  

While you might think crooked teeth are only a cosmetic issue, they can become an open gateway for bacteria to infect our mouth. It is because some parts of our teeth can’t be adequately brushed, causing plaque and tartar to form, and the teeth start to decay.

Cosmetic dentists highly recommend straightening crooked teeth with orthodontic treatments, such as wearing dental braces or clear aligners.  

When You Have a Missing Tooth

Another reason why we are less confident in smiling is that we have a missing tooth! Missing teeth can impact your appearance and oral health. That is why you should see a cosmetic dentist!

Missing teeth can cause the jawbones to deteriorate at a faster rate. Since the teeth surrounding the gap can shift over time, it can cause facial deformation, too. Gum atrophy can also happen since the gums will be lacking in structural support.  

A missing tooth can be caused by accidents that substantially impact our teeth or by having a tooth extracted because of the severe infection present.

Dental implants can be attached to toothless bone sockets as replacements for lost teeth. Not only does it restore your confidence in your smiles, but it also adds comfort when you eat or drink your favorites!
